Three Vietnamese passengers were arrested at the Suvarnabhumi Airport early Sunday on charges of rhino-horn smuggling.

The haul is worth more than Bt15 million.
Arrested as they entered the country were Yoeng Ba Ngia, 27, Nguen Thi Thujang, 30, and Pham Thi Thanghuei, 56.
Found in the luggage bags were 15 rhino horns weighing about 7.4 kilograms.
Customs officials said the three suspects, who all work in Angola, admitted to having been paid Bt32,000 each to carry the rhino horns from Angola to Vietnam.

Airport authorities say they received a tip-off that rhino-horn smugglers would board a flight from Angola’s Luanda to Vietnam’s Hanoi via Ethiopia and then Thailand. 
They thus paid extra attention to air passengers travelling on that route.
